上海菟丝子网络有限公司分享:程序开发中的性能优化关键指标与实战方法

首页 / 新闻资讯 / 上海菟丝子网络有限公司分享:程序开发中的

上海菟丝子网络有限公司分享:程序开发中的性能优化关键指标与实战方法

📅 2026-05-18 🔖 上海菟丝子网络有限公司,网络科技,程序开发,流量运营,互联网项目,平台搭建

性能瓶颈:从“能用”到“好用”的鸿沟

在当下的互联网项目竞争中,用户对响应速度的容忍度已降至毫秒级。作为深耕程序开发多年的技术团队,上海菟丝子网络有限公司观察到:许多平台搭建初期往往只关注功能实现,而忽略了性能优化。当流量涌入时,系统响应时间从200ms飙升到3秒以上,直接导致用户流失率增加40%。这背后,是代码逻辑、数据库查询、以及架构设计等多重因素的累积效应。

问题剖析:90%的性能问题源自这三类“暗伤”

我们复盘了近期经手的多个网络科技项目,发现性能瓶颈通常集中在以下三类场景:

  • 数据库查询效率低下:未合理使用索引,或存在大量N+1查询。例如某社交应用,单次用户信息拉取触发了30次独立SQL,耗时高达1.2秒。
  • 资源加载与缓存策略失当:静态资源未压缩、未使用CDN,或缓存过期时间设置不合理。一个流量运营活动页,因未配置浏览器缓存,首屏加载时间多出800ms。
  • 代码层面的冗余计算:循环内执行高开销操作(如正则匹配、JSON序列化),或者未对热点数据进行预处理。

实战解法:从数据指标到代码落地的三步法

针对上述问题,上海菟丝子网络有限公司在程序开发实践中总结了一套“指标-定位-优化”的闭环方法。首先,需要确立关键指标:核心网页指标(Core Web Vitals)中的LCP(最大内容绘制)应控制在2.5秒内,FID(首次输入延迟)低于100ms。这些数据是衡量用户体验的硬标准。

其次,借助性能分析工具(如Xdebug、Chrome DevTools的Performance面板)进行精准定位。我们曾为一个电商平台搭建项目优化首页,通过火焰图发现,一个未加缓存的商品分类树组件,单次渲染耗时占整个页面加载的32%。

从代码到基础设施:两个立竿见影的优化方向

  1. 数据库层面:采用延迟关联(Deferred Join)技术,先通过索引缩小数据范围,再关联获取完整记录。某统计报表查询从7秒降至0.4秒。
  2. 缓存策略:对热点数据使用Redis做二级缓存,并设置合理的过期时间(如用户会话数据设为15分钟)。同时,对静态资源启用强缓存(Cache-Control: max-age=31536000)并配合版本号更新。

在流量运营高峰期,这些优化能让服务器吞吐量提升3-5倍,有效降低云资源成本。

实践建议:将性能优化融入开发流程

性能优化不应是上线前的“救火”行为。我们建议在每次代码提交(Commit)时,设置自动化性能预算(Performance Budget),例如:页面总资源大小不超过500KB,API响应时间不超过200ms。一旦超出,CI/CD流水线应自动告警并阻断合并。此外,定期对核心接口做压力测试(如使用JMeter或Locust),模拟真实流量波动,提前发现连接池耗尽或SQL慢查询等隐患。

对于互联网项目平台搭建类需求,上海菟丝子网络有限公司始终强调:性能是设计出来的,而非测试出来的。从架构选型(如微服务拆分粒度)到代码细节(如避免频繁new大对象),每一个环节都值得投入。

技术迭代永无止境,但核心原则不变:以数据驱动决策,用工程化手段保证效果。当你的系统能在流量洪峰中依然保持丝滑体验时,性能优化的价值便不言自明。

相关推荐

📄

2024年网络科技趋势下上海菟丝子程序开发服务升级要点

2026-05-20

📄

2024年互联网项目开发中上海菟丝子网络有限公司服务优势分析

2026-05-16

📄

上海菟丝子网络有限公司流量运营方案与平台搭建技术优势解析

2026-05-05

📄

2024年上海菟丝子网络有限公司程序开发成本优化与实施策略

2026-04-29

📄

上海菟丝子网络有限公司网络科技定制化系统开发应用案例

2026-05-18

📄

上海菟丝子网络有限公司平台搭建技术架构与性能优势解析

2026-05-13